**14:22 — Incremental rebuild regression confirmed.** Pagelith's dependency graph dropped edges for plugins registering virtual routes, so partial rebuilds skipped affected pages. Plugin authors: builds after v3.1 must declare route ownership explicitly or invalidation will miss your output. Full rebuilds were forced as mitigation at 14:40. The first failing rebuild is traceable under the token below.

trace token, fafog-kageg: htk4_98e6

Re: PR #412 — Pointstack ledger accrual path. I walked through the double-entry logic carefully and the balancing invariant holds, but please note the reconciliation sweep now reads uncommitted accrual rows when the batch window overlaps a redemption. That's exploitable if a client races redemptions against the sweep, so the lock window and retry caps matter more than usual here. I'd like the security team to confirm the chosen bounds are defensible before merge. For reference, the constants under review are:

constants for hahof-bajep:
THRESHOLDS = {
    "sorwyn": 797,
    "jorath": 933,
    "pramir": 998,
    "wenath": 950,
    "silok": 489,
    "prawyn": 572,
    "praiel": 821,
}

One concern: the gradual-ramp scheduler in `RampController.evaluate()` reads its thresholds from module-level constants, but the comments don't explain why the step size doubles after the third stage. Please document the reasoning, since anyone adjusting these without context could push a flag to 100% far faster than intended. Also confirm the jitter window was validated against the Brightmoor staging cluster, not just unit tests. For reference while reviewing, these are the current tuning constants as merged.

tuning constants:
RATE_LIMITS = {
    "goriel": 284,
    "brieth": 236,
    "lamvan": 916,
    "druok": 255,
    "wenion": 979,
    "istmir": 343,
    "queniel": 302,
}